Suspected Norway spy didn't work on defense projects
|
August 19, 2020 1:27 AM
COPENHAGEN, Denmark (AP) — A man who is in custody in Norway suspected of spying for Russia was heading an industry project on 3D printing and had no security clearance and didn’t work on projects for the defense industry, the Norwegian Armed Forces or other governmental agencies, his employer said.
